How to Protect Data on a Laptop

❎ A strong password is not enough to keep your laptop data safe. Laptops get lost and stolen all the time, and a password alone will not protect what is on yours. I'll cover four steps that actually lock down your data, plus a real story about what can go wrong. ❎ Protecting laptop data Lock your UEFI/BIOS with a password to prevent unauthorized people from booting the machine or making changes. Lock your hard disk with whole-disk encryption to prevent data access, even if the drive is physically removed. Secure your login with a strong password to prevent the exposure of data. Lock your machine with a physical lock to prevent someone from stealing it and attempting to break in at their leisure.
